AAUW gears up for fashion show

The Whidbey Island Branch of American Association of University Women is planning their Annual Spring Luncheon and Fashion Show to be held Thursday, March 25, at the Whidbey Golf & Country Club, Oak Harbor.

No-host cocktails will be offered from 11 a.m. to noon. AAUW models will highlight fashions from owner Deb Crocker’s Coupeville stores, “Beyond the Sea,” “One More Thing” and “Back to the Island” which will feature lovely accessories from scarves to handbags and jewelry, and great jackets, sweaters and slacks.

AAUW is a national organization over 125 years old whose mission is advancing equity for women and girls through education, advocacy and research. Proceeds from this fundraiser will go toward scholarships for Whidbey Island students.

The Whidbey AAUW branch was established in 1995 with only 10 women but now includes nearly 100 members. Learn more by visiting www.whidbeyisland@aauw-wa.org.
